The Role

FUNCTIONS Manages reporting around the Bank’s portfolio of projects, resource planning and utilization, IT expenditures and budgeting, and other performance indicators. Oversees tracking and reporting processes. Tracks and maintains knowledge of the department’s vendors and service agreements. Flexibly assists with technical tasks such as computer assistance, PC troubleshooting, and helping find other technical solutions. Handles day-to-day office administrative tasks and assists with other work efforts.

ACCOUNTABILITIES

Data Collection and Reporting:

  • Assists IT Management in collecting and reporting key performance indicators
  • Oversees project intake process
  • Prepares reports on resource utilization and forecasts upcoming usage
  • Coordinates IT Vendor Management Program
  • Tracks departmental accounts payable and prepares financial reports
  • Other tasks as requested.

Tasks:

  • Prepare incoming invoices for management to approve
  • Prepare departmental budget
  • Software and Hardware procurement
  • ITOC administrative duties and supporting functions (recording minutes, preparing agenda).
  • CCB administrative tasks (preparing agenda and supplementary packet, tracking votes).
  • Work Program administrative duties and oversight (enforcing monthly updates, tracking changes).
  • Contract scanning, filing.
  • Contract/service agreement lifecycle management.
  • Assists the CIO as necessary.
  • Administrative tasks for the department/management (supply order, ordering lunches, scheduling meetings and interviews, etc.)

Desktop Support:

  • Assists Help Desk staff by responding to requests for assistance via phone, email, and web
  • Maintains a basic knowledge of Bank systems, applications, and hardware
  • Performs troubleshooting and maintenance as necessary for desktop hardware and software
  • Escalates problems appropriately
